Micheline, I really feel for you, it does sound like you are doing many right things, some dogs challenge us to get creative and try other things. Just now I'm due for a meeting with my new boss but will check back later. Does she act fearful in the back yard? Can you perhaps set aside a really long time, like an hour, if need be to just sit out there with her? Take a good book or something? This might work best the first time she is taken out in the morning, she MUST have to pee and perhaps just waiting her out with calm patience will help her decide that the backyard is an ok place to pee again. If she has poo'd in the back, are you keeping it scooped and cleaned up so she doesn't think 'oh my, what a nasty place, I'm not going here!' :D

Micheline:
Does Chin Chin like to go for walks? Does she like to go outside to play?

If so, she may be peeing on the floor in an effort to be taken outside. She has figured out that if she pees outside --- you bring her in and since she wants to be outside or play outside, then she's using the restroom in the house in an effort to be taken out.

Just a thought, dogs are not as dumb as some people think they are. Then on the other hand....some are just not the brightest star in the sky.

If you are using a carpet cleaner machine (that uses hot water) --- you may be doing more to set the stain and smell because hot water will do this and the smell will come back with a vengenance. If the smell is in the pad (underneath) the carpet --- there is NO way to get the smell out except pull up the carpet, take the old pad out and put new in its place. She can still smell the spot where she peed, that is why she's still peeing there.

Just curious and you dont' have to answer this ..... but her not wanting to go to the back yard: think of anything unpleasant that may have occured in the backyard. Did you ever take her to the backyard to use the restroom and since she was taking so long, you became impatient, yelled at her, scolded her, jerked her, or anything else that may have made her think that being in the backyard was unpleasant?

Perhaps if you buy a small pack of puppy pee pads, put a pad down in the spot where she last peed. Pretty much know she will pee in the house at least once more right? :D If she pees on the pad, save it! Don't throw it away! Next time you take her outside, take the pad too. With luck and good karma she'll pee on the pad again. Immediately flip pad over and press pee into ground! Transfer scent to the ground where you want her to pee. Praise praise!
